Which of the following is/ are characteristics of simple harmonic motion?
I. The acceleration is constant .
II. The restoring force is proportional to the displacement.
III. The frequency is independent of the amplitude.
II only
I and II only
I and III only
II and III only
I, II, and III

A linear spring of force constant k is used in physics lab experiment. A block of mass m is attached to the spring and the resulting frequency, f, of the simple harmonic oscillation is measured. Blocks of various masses are used in different trials, and in each case, the corresponding frequency is measured and recorded. If f2 is plotted versus 1/m, the graph will be a straight line with slope
4π2/k2
4π2/k
(4π)(2k)
k/4π2
k2/4π2

A simple pendulum swings about the vertical equilibrium position with a maximum angular displacement of 5o and period T. If the same pendulum is given a maximum angular displacement of 10o, then which of the following best gives the period of the oscillations?
T/2
T/√2
T
T√2
2T
